1051810241 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 1051810242. Its totient is φ = 1051810240.

The previous prime is 1051810237. The next prime is 1051810261. The reversal of 1051810241 is 1420181501.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 989731600 + 62078641 = 31460^2 + 7879^2 .

It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(1420181501) is a distict prime.
